Transaction 396840d56ecff7e1703bf73abf86eedf2f6fe23a6b7cb1d45604792f01268afc

1 Input
2 Outputs
  • 396840d56ecff7e1703bf73abf86eedf2f6fe23a6b7cb1d45604792f01268afc:0
  • value  260222
    address  3KEhzjHQhtbvP887phUm6RrjDhktTqPEsP
  • 396840d56ecff7e1703bf73abf86eedf2f6fe23a6b7cb1d45604792f01268afc:1
  • value  53903223
    address  bc1q7ug4w4as2sefar89q057hnmxkakp58a25535ttlmurn6cncs8tms4e7gp2